What To Do Immediately
- Remove or elevate valuable items and furniture where possible
- Note the approximate time the water damage started, for your insurance claim
- Keep receipts for any temporary repairs or emergency supplies you purchase
- Call a restoration professional as soon as possible
- Take photos and videos of the damage for insurance documentation
What Not To Do
- Do not turn on ceiling fixtures if the ceiling is wet
- Do not attempt to dry out large areas with household fans alone — professional drying equipment moves far more air
- Do not assume carpet padding can be saved once it has been soaked for more than a few hours
- Do not walk through standing water if you suspect it may be electrically charged

What's the difference between water damage restoration and mold remediation in Mooresville?
Water damage restoration focuses on extracting water, drying structures, and repairing affected materials. Mold remediation is a separate, specialized process for removing existing mold growth. Addressing water damage quickly is the best way to avoid needing mold remediation later.

Can water damage lead to mold in Mooresville properties?
Yes — mold can begin developing within 24 to 48 hours after a water event, particularly in humid conditions. Thorough extraction and structural drying, not just surface cleanup, is the most effective way to prevent mold growth after water damage.
